Explore the dynamic world of skateboarding in "Skateboarding Between Subculture and the Olympic – A Youth Culture Under Pressure from Commercialization and Sportification" by Jürgen Schwier. Published in 2021 by Transcript Verlag, this thought-provoking anthology spans 220 pages and features contributions from twelve international authors, each providing a unique analytical perspective on the evolving relationship between skateboarding and the Olympics.
This insightful examination delves into the tensions faced by skateboarding as it transitions from an underground subculture to a mainstream sport.
